如何构建个性化AI语音助手应用
在人工智能迅速发展的今天,个性化AI语音助手应用已经成为我们日常生活中不可或缺的一部分。它们不仅能够帮助我们处理日常事务,还能为我们提供个性化服务,让我们的生活变得更加便捷。那么,如何构建一个具有强大功能的个性化AI语音助手应用呢?本文将通过讲述一位AI语音助手开发者的故事,来探讨这个问题。
李明,一位年轻的AI语音助手开发者,从小就对人工智能充满了浓厚的兴趣。他大学毕业后,毅然决然地投身于这个领域,立志要为人们打造一个真正智能的语音助手。经过几年的努力,他终于成功开发出一款具有个性化功能的AI语音助手应用——小智。
小智是一款基于深度学习技术的智能语音助手,它能够根据用户的使用习惯、兴趣爱好和需求,为用户提供个性化的服务。以下是李明在构建小智过程中的一些关键步骤:
一、需求分析
在开发小智之前,李明首先进行了详细的需求分析。他通过问卷调查、访谈等方式,了解了用户在使用语音助手时最关心的问题,以及他们对个性化服务的期望。经过分析,他总结出以下几个关键需求:
- 语音识别准确率高;
- 能够根据用户喜好推荐内容;
- 支持多种场景应用;
- 保障用户隐私安全。
二、技术选型
根据需求分析,李明选择了以下技术:
- 语音识别:采用百度、科大讯飞等知名语音识别厂商提供的API,确保语音识别准确率;
- 自然语言处理:使用开源的NLP工具,如jieba、NLTK等,实现语义理解、情感分析等功能;
- 深度学习:运用TensorFlow、PyTorch等深度学习框架,训练个性化推荐模型;
- 云计算:利用阿里云、腾讯云等云服务提供商,实现高并发、低延迟的服务。
三、个性化推荐算法
为了实现个性化推荐,李明采用了以下算法:
- 用户画像:根据用户的历史行为数据,如搜索记录、浏览记录等,构建用户画像;
- 内容推荐:基于用户画像,结合机器学习算法,为用户推荐感兴趣的内容;
- 模型优化:通过不断优化模型,提高推荐准确率和用户体验。
四、安全保障
为了保障用户隐私安全,小智采取了以下措施:
- 数据加密:对用户数据进行加密存储,防止数据泄露;
- 用户授权:用户可自主选择授权哪些数据被用于个性化推荐;
- 透明化:用户可随时查看自己的数据使用情况,对数据使用进行管理。
五、产品迭代
在产品上线后,李明并没有停止脚步。他根据用户反馈,不断优化小智的功能和性能。以下是一些重要的迭代方向:
- 优化语音识别准确率,提高用户体验;
- 丰富个性化推荐内容,满足用户多样化需求;
- 开发更多场景应用,如智能家居、出行助手等;
- 加强与其他平台的合作,拓展用户群体。
经过不懈努力,小智逐渐成为一款深受用户喜爱的AI语音助手应用。它不仅为用户提供了便捷的服务,还帮助用户节省了大量时间。以下是李明在构建小智过程中的一些感悟:
- 用户体验至上:在开发过程中,始终将用户体验放在首位,关注用户需求,不断优化产品;
- 技术创新:紧跟人工智能领域的技术发展趋势,不断尝试新技术,提升产品竞争力;
- 团队协作:组建一支富有激情、富有创新精神的团队,共同为产品迭代贡献力量;
- 持续优化:在产品上线后,持续关注用户反馈,不断优化产品,提升用户体验。
总之,构建一个具有个性化功能的AI语音助手应用,需要开发者具备敏锐的市场洞察力、扎实的专业技术能力和坚定的信念。通过不断努力,相信未来会有更多优秀的AI语音助手应用走进我们的生活,为我们带来更加便捷、智能的生活体验。
猜你喜欢:AI陪聊软件